The Upcoming.org Archives
Lily Allen, the Bird and the Bee
April 11, 2007
Fillmore New York at Irving Plaza
17 Irving Pl
New York,
New York
10003
Added by
acloudman
on March 17, 2007
Comments
BaCaNTi
Where do I get tickets for this show!??!?!
acloudman
Sold out :(
Interested
7
acloudman
dacaplan
morninglemon
ryankicks
streetforce1
taliapage
TriniPrincess
BaCaNTi
Where do I get tickets for this show!??!?!